The Role
- Conduct Management, Refurbishment, and Demolition Surveys in line with HSG264 guidance
- Survey a range of commercial, industrial, and domestic properties
- Identify and assess asbestos containing materials
- Produce accurate and compliant asbestos survey reports
- Liaise with clients, contractors, and internal teams
- Ensure all work complies with current legislation and HSE guidance
Requirements
- BOHS P402 qualification (or equivalent)
- Previous experience working as an Asbestos Surveyor within a UKAS accredited consultancy
- Strong knowledge of asbestos legislation and guidance
- Good report writing and communication skills
- Ability to manage workload independently
- Full UK driving licence
